Covid-19 Will Not Be the Only Virus Obesity Affects

In a previous article, we established that obesity is an independent variable as a factor for hospitalization after patients contract COVID-19. In one study, it was the most common factor for hospitalizations second only to hypertension. Although shocking, this does make sense. After all, 42% of Americans are obese. By the numbers, it would translate that they make up a higher percentage of the hospitalized population. But why is this a reality?

What is laparoscopic surgery?

Although the word laparoscopic sounds super complex, its meaning is simple. The term laparoscopic refers to surgical techniques that are “minimally invasive.” These techniques have been developed over the past two decades and continue to advance.
